python如何清空列表

原创
admin 10小时前 阅读数 2 #Python

Python中清空列表的方法

Python中,清空列表是一个常见的操作,有多种方法可以清空列表,下面是一些常用的方法:

1、使用clear()方法清空列表

clear()方法是Python内置的空列表方法,可以清空任何类型的列表,使用clear()方法时,只需要在列表对象上调用该方法即可。

my_list = [1, 2, 3, 4, 5]
my_list.clear()
print(my_list)  # 输出: []

2、使用del语句清空列表

除了使用clear()方法外,还可以使用del语句来清空列表,使用del语句时,需要指定要删除的元素范围,

my_list = [1, 2, 3, 4, 5]
del my_list[0:len(my_list)]
print(my_list)  # 输出: []

3、使用列表推导式清空列表

还可以使用列表推导式来清空列表,列表推导式是一种简洁的Python代码风格,可以用来创建新列表或操作现有列表。

my_list = [1, 2, 3, 4, 5]
my_list = []
print(my_list)  # 输出: []

需要注意的是,使用列表推导式时,需要重新定义列表对象,因为列表推导式会创建一个新的空列表,并覆盖原有的列表对象。

Python提供了多种方法来清空列表,可以根据具体的需求和场景选择适合的方法。

作者文章
热门
最新文章